About

This app uses your device's camera to analyze calf raise performance through video. It measures height, power, and work, and calculates a fatigue index. Track progress over time and compare left and right leg performance.

Video analysis of calf raises
Measures heel height, power, and work
Calculates fatigue index
Supports external load for strength testing
Multi-user support
Data export to CSV
Integrated metronome

How does Calf Raise measure performance?

Calf Raise uses your device's camera to record videos of your calf raises. It then employs validated tracking algorithms to analyze the trajectory of a marker on your heel, calculating key performance metrics.

What metrics does Calf Raise provide?

Calf Raise provides detailed information including total and peak heel height, power, and work. It also calculates a fatigue index by comparing the first and last repetitions.

Can Calf Raise be used for strength testing with weights?

Yes, Calf Raise allows you to enter an additional load used during testing. This feature is designed to measure strength more than endurance, making it versatile for different testing needs.
